Is Miss Vickies Jalapeno Flavored Kettle Cooked Potato Chips Vegan?

No. This product is not vegan as it lists 2 ingredients that derive from animals and 2 ingredients that could could derive from animals depending on the source.

Description

Bold jalapeño heat with smoky undertones and a kettle-cooked, crunchy texture; thick, ridged chips hold up well for dipping. Commonly eaten as a standalone snack, at parties, or paired with sandwiches and beer. Reviewers generally report consistent crunch and pronounced spice, while some note occasional variability in heat between bags.

Ingredients

Potatoes, Vegetable Oil (sunflower, Canola And/or Corn Oil), Jalapeno Seasoning (maltodextrin [made From Corn], Salt, Dextrose, Onion Powder, Torula Yeast, Spices, Whey, Paprika, Natural Flavors, Sunflower Oil, Garlic Powder, Jalapeno Pepper Powder, Yeast Extract). Milk

What is a Vegan diet?

A vegan diet excludes all animal-derived foods, including meat, poultry, fish, dairy, eggs, and honey. It focuses on plant-based sources such as fruits, vegetables, grains, legumes, nuts, and seeds. Many people choose veganism for ethical, environmental, or health reasons. When well-planned, it provides sufficient protein, fiber, and antioxidants, though supplementation or fortified foods may be needed for nutrients like vitamin B12, iron, and omega-3 fatty acids. Vegan diets are associated with lower risks of heart disease and improved digestion but require mindfulness to ensure balanced and complete nutrition.
